Ruth K. Jadwin-Bell
November 24, 1929 ~ February 13, 2010
Ruth K. Jadwin-Bell, 80, of Angleton passed away Saturday, February 13, 2010 in Angleton.
Ruth was born in Clinton, Kentucky on November 24, 1929 to Clois and Ora Kaler. She was preceeded in death by her parents and first husband, John Paul Jadwin. She is survived by her husband James H. Bell; daughters, Lynn Cantu and husband Alfredo, Sandra Bowers and husband William; sons, Ken Bell and wife Sonya and Lonnie Bell; grandchildren, Alana Kaler Bailey, Olivia Nichole Cantu, Cassandra Cantu, Holly Bell, Rachel Bell, Mathew Bell, and Jamie Bell; great grand children, Jayden Marksberry, Mykayla Gordon, Addison Bell, Karrie Bell and Whitley Young.
Ruth was a member of Moore Memorial United Methodist Church in Winona, Mississippi, and attended First United Methodist Church in Angleton. She loved to knit and crochet, and she loved animals. She was full of life and liked to dance. She was also active in civic organizations, and loved to work with people. She was a grief counselor and a member of the visiting nurses organization.
